Accurate Benchmarking
Benchmark.js provides accurate and reliable performance tests for JavaScript code by internally handling variations and measurement issues, offering confidence in the benchmarks produced.
Cross-Platform Compatibility
This library is compatible with different JavaScript environments, including browsers and Node.js, allowing developers to use it across various platforms without modification.
High Resolution Timing
Benchmark.js takes advantage of high-resolution timers to offer precise measurements of performance, which is crucial for sophisticated benchmarking needs.
Rich Feature Set
The library offers various utilities and features, such as statistical data, deep comparisons, and asynchronous testing capabilities, making it versatile for complex use cases.

We have a series of benchmark suites using https://benchmarkjs.com/. Every CI run saves the results of the benchmarks to a json file that we persist across runs and can compare against. Source: over 4 years ago
We use https://benchmarkjs.com/ to get statistically significant results, then write the results with the git hash to get a view of performance after every CI build. Source: over 4 years ago
